Dominik Käppeler (* 1988 in Göppingen ) is a German chef .

Career

The son of a restaurant owner began his training at Feinkost Käfer in Munich when he was 15 . In 2006 he moved to the Egern 51 restaurant in Rottach-Egern , in 2007 to the Da Mimmo restaurant in Bad Wiessee and in 2008 to the Park Hotel Egerner Höfe in Rottach-Egern. In 2009 the Maiwerts Fährhütte restaurant at Dieter Maiwert's in Rottach-Egern (one Michelin star ) followed, and in 2010 the Altwirt Hotel and Restaurant in Großhartpenning . In 2011 he became head chef at the Hotel Bachmair am See in Rottach-Egern and in 2013 at the Fährhütte am See in Rottach-Egern. In 2014 he moved to Beach38 in Munich. In 2015 he went to the Schweiger 2 restaurant next to Andreas Schweiger (one Michelin star ).

In 2017 he took over the restaurant, which is now called the Showroom . It was awarded one star by the Michelin Guide in 2017 .

In February 2019, an image video about Käppeler from Mercedes-Benz was published.

Awards

  • since 2015: One star in the 2018 Michelin Guide for the Showroom restaurant in Munich
  • since 2015: 3 F in the Feinschmecker magazine
  • since 2015: 7/10 pans in taste
